View Our Website View All Jobs

Distributed Systems Software Engineer, Cloud

This is a great opportunity for a talented and hands-on Cloud Architect to step up to the next level, and build secure cloud services for users of the world’s best-selling mobile devices. The Samsung Mobile Cloud Services Team is focused on the rapid development of cloud based end-to-end mobile applications and services. This is an exciting area for Samsung: Cloud based service platforms and infrastructure to support mobility. Come join the Samsung Mobile Cloud Services team and help us define and develop the future role of smartphones and services!

Position Summary:

The Cloud services group is looking for world class server software engineers to join our technology innovation group focused on the rapid development of cloud based end-to-end mobile applications and services. This is an exciting area for Samsung: Cloud based service platforms and infrastructure to support mobility.

Responsibilities Include:

Implement, maintain and evolve cloud-based products and services

Integrate with external customer and 3rd-party systems

Perform extensive research and analysis to make optimal architecture and design decisions

Analyze and improve security for Cloud application, provide expert guidance to Engineers on security

Write large amounts of code, perform code reviews, write unit tests

Write documentation

Interface with other groups including Product Management, QA and Operations

Create quick proof-of-concept prototypes

Participate in scrum team

Experience Requirements:

BS or MS in Computer Science or equivalent experience

Strong computer science fundamentals in data structures and algorithms

Hands-on experience developing applications for highly available, scalable and distributed systems

Multi-year experience developing in Java

Good working knowledge of stream and batch processing, distributed caching and messaging systems

Experience developing micro-services based cloud products

Experience with Oauth, OpenID and IAM frameworks

Experience working with Nginx

Good working knowledge of SQL and NoSQL databases

Preferred Experience Requirements:

Experience in Big Data technologies like EMR, HBase, Phoenix and Spark

Apache Kafka

Redis

 

Samsung is an EEO/Veterans/Disabled/LGBT employer. We welcome and encourage diversity as we strive to create an inclusive workplace.

Read More

Apply for this position

Required*
Apply with Indeed
Attach resume as .pdf, .doc, .docx, .odt, or .rtf (limit 5MB) or Paste resume

Paste your resume here or Attach resume file